Battery charger recommendations please
Hi David, The quiescent drain for our cars is 30 milliamperes or 0.03A so not very high at all. This is also easily checked. I would ensure the day before you leave, you allow your CTEK to fully charge the battery. However, it would be worth having the capacity of the battery checked as it may have dropped from lack of use. Lead sulphate begins to form at 12.4v and its these sulphites that strangle the battery.

S Type 2006 2.7 deisel wiring diagarm.
Yes it does. The most common problem for a drain is the ”alarm chirp sounder”. The internal rechargeable batteries short out over time causing the drain. The other is the little flap in the ignition barrel not closing when the key is removed. The easiest way to deal with the sounder is to simply disconnect it and then see if the battery is still discharging. The ignition switch flap will just need a little graphite grease to lubricate it, if indeed it is stuck open.

xk drive door mirror
Hi Allan, Put the mirror in it’s driving position first. Now adjust the glass inwards. Now put your fingers into the side of the glass and simply pull. It will just pop of it’s mounting. Make sure your other hand is there to steady the glass in case it falls.

XK battery going flat.
Not quite Pete. As soon as you reconnect the battery, the infotainment centre will flash up and that is where your 9A is coming from. You would need to wait 30 minutes for the various modules to shutdown to get a more accurate reading of any parasitic drain. The most common fault is the alarm chirp sounder internal batteries shorting out causing the drain. The sounder sits under the driver’s side bonnet hinge and is quite fiddly to get to.
